PointsLedger tracks loyalty accruals for Marnova Retail. Three environments: dev, staging, prod. Each runs an isolated ledger database; no cross-environment replication. Staging receives scrubbed copies of prod balances weekly. Write access in prod is restricted to the accrual worker and the reconciliation job. All mutation endpoints require signed requests; audit events ship to the central log sink within five seconds. TLS is terminated at the internal gateway only. The current prod configuration values for review are listed below.

deployment values, tajeg-kaduf:
[kelius]
port = 9300
region = upper-3
host = kelius.zemvardata.corp
team = sildor
timeout_ms = 2000
retries = 8

**Onboarding: reviewing changes to `pixfold` (batch image resize CLI)**

When reviewing `pixfold` pull requests, run the golden-image suite locally before approving; the CI runners at Tarnwick occasionally skip the EXIF-preservation checks. Resize logic lives in `core/scaler`, and anything touching the output-signing path needs a second reviewer. To run the signing tests, you'll need to unlock the local test vault with its recovery passphrase, shown below.

recovery phrase for fajep-yaweg: gilath-sorox-wenius-rusdor-keliel-zorius

Subject: Quickstore 4.2 — bloom filter now fronts the KV layer

Plugin authors: starting with this release, Quickstore places a bloom filter ahead of the key-value store. Negative lookups return faster; false positives fall through safely. No API changes are required on your side. Verify your plugin against the staging build referenced below.

session token of fahif-tadup = htk3_9c7